C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: error 017: undefined symbol "PlayerInfo" C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: warning 215: expression has no effect C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: error 001: expected token: ";", but found "]" C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: error 029: invalid expression, assumed zero C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: fatal error 107: too many error messages on one line
PlayerInfo[playerid][pModel] = Peds[classid][0];
PD: el sistema de registro tampoco lo hago yonew PlayerInfo[MAX_PLAYERS][pInfo];
|
No tienes definido el :
Код:
new PlayerInfo[MAX_PLAYERS][pInfo]; |
si lo tengo definido new PlayerInfo[MAX_PLAYERS][pInfo];
public OnPlayerRequestClass(playerid, classid)
{
new string[128];
PlayerPlaySound(playerid, 1068, 0.0, 0.0, 0.0);
PlayerInfo[playerid][pModel] = Peds[classid][0];
if(IsPlayerNPC(playerid))
{
OnPlayerSpawn(playerid);
SpawnPlayer(playerid);
return 1;
}
if (gPlayerLogged[playerid] != 1)
{
ClearChatbox(playerid, 10);
format(string, sizeof(string), "Bienvenido a SF-RP, Versiуn %s", SCRIPT_VERSION);
SendClientMessage(playerid, COLOR_YELLOW, string);
if(gPlayerAccount[playerid] == 1)
{
new loginmsg[256+1];
new loginname[MAX_PLAYER_NAME+1];
GetPlayerName(playerid,loginname,MAX_PLAYER_NAME);
format(loginmsg,256,"Tu cuenta ya esta registrada!\nSolo tienes que insertar tu contraseсa\n\nNombre de Cuenta:\t%s\nContraseсa:",loginname);
ShowPlayerDialog(playerid,1,DIALOG_STYLE_INPUT,"Bienvenido",loginmsg,"Entrar","Salir");
SetPlayerCameraPos(playerid, -1993.0938,212.7325,111.8599); // cam inicio
SetPlayerPos(playerid, -1953.0776,386.6941,112.4465); // cam inicio
SetPlayerCameraLookAt(playerid, -1953.0776,386.6941,112.4465);
SetPlayerVirtualWorld(playerid, 0);
SetPlayerInterior(playerid, 0);
PlayerPlaySound(playerid, 1187, 0.0, 0.0, 0.0);
PlayerInfo[playerid][pModel] = Peds[classid][0];
return 1;
}
else if(gPlayerAccount[playerid] == 0)
{
new loginmsg[256+1];
new loginname[MAX_PLAYER_NAME+1];
GetPlayerName(playerid,loginname,MAX_PLAYER_NAME);
format(loginmsg,256,"Para entrar tienes que registrar tu cuenta\nNombre de Cuenta:\t%s\nEscribe tu nueva contraseсa\nRecuerda usar Mayusculas en Nombre_Apellido",loginname);
ShowPlayerDialog(playerid,0,DIALOG_STYLE_INPUT,"Bienvenido",loginmsg,"Registrar","Salir");
SetPlayerCameraPos(playerid, -1993.0938,212.7325,111.8599); // cam inicio
SetPlayerPos(playerid, -1953.0776,386.6941,112.4465); // cam inicio
SetPlayerCameraLookAt(playerid, -1953.0776,386.6941,112.4465);
SetPlayerVirtualWorld(playerid, 0);
SetPlayerInterior(playerid, 0);
PlayerPlaySound(playerid, 1185, 0.0, 0.0, 0.0);
PlayerInfo[playerid][pModel] = Peds[classid][0];
return 1;
}
}
SetupPlayerForClassSelection(playerid);
SetPlayerInterior(playerid,14);
SetPlayerPos(playerid,258.4893,-41.4008,1002.0234);
SetPlayerFacingAngle(playerid, 270.0);
SetPlayerCameraPos(playerid,256.0815,-43.0475,1004.0234);
SetPlayerCameraLookAt(playerid,258.4893,-41.4008,1002.0234);
// else SpawnPlayer(playerid);
return 1;
}
public SetupPlayerForClassSelection(playerid)
{
new skin = GetPlayerSkin(playerid);
PlayerInfo[playerid][pChar] = skin;
}
C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: error 017: undefined symbol "PlayerInfo"
C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: warning 215: expression has no effect
C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: error 001: expected token: ";", but found "]"
C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: error 029: invalid expression, assumed zero
C:\Users\AngelusChesus\Downloads\Proyecto Pawno\Server convertido a 3.C\samp03csvr_win32\gamemodes\Xchel.pwn(326) : fatal error 107: too many error messages on one line
//Todo los errores se solucionaran resolviendo el 1ro
new PlayerInfo[MAX_PLAYERS][pInfo]; //pInfo en caso de que tengas enums xd
|
PD: si gustan no me hagan el comando, no quiero ser copy-paste solo quiero que me expliquen porque da esos errores y que debo hacer la proxima vez |
|
pawn Код:
pawn Код:
Bien dicho.. |
muchas gracias amigo !!! re lo agradezco mucho